I had a fantastic meal at The Kitchen. The entire menu is farm to table seasonal. Make a reservation!
LINK
Foolish Craigs is pretty popular. It was on DDD if that means anything to you. It's pretty good "cafe" food with Beers and such.
LINK
If you happen to venture into Denver, I really like Osteria Marco. Its GREAT italian food. They have house made cheeses that are pretty damn good.
I think about their Fig Pizza almost every time I have pizza: Fig Speck, Goat Cheese, Fontina, Black Mission Figs, Arugula

I second the Kitchen. Backcountry Pizza is a cool spot. I also really like Bru in Boulder.
You should go to Lyons and visit Oskar Blues. It is kid friendly and just cool with decent food and great beer. Also St Vrain in Lyons has great sandwiches that are awesome to pick up then eat in Rocky Mountain National Park after a hike.
If you are coming here expecting great food, then don't. We do beer, weed and outdoor activities better than anyone but the food is lacking.
Also if you do any hiking in the front range under 8000' keep an eye and an ear out for rattlesnakes, they have been pretty bad this year.
Eta- pizzeria locale is indeed legit and worth a visit
